FAKE FAKE FAKE FAKE!!!!
Absolute bunch of crap. I've just come back from SE and should've picked up a pair there. These are FAKE! The sole is made of foam NOT rubber like they should be (see pic, foam squishes, rubber doesn't). The straps are cheap plastic and twisted. Not happy. I bought these to replace my two year old pair, these aren't going to last two minutes!

They are great, as a torture device.
These are the most badly designed flip flops I've ever seen, I don't know how it has so many good reviews. The problem is that the rubber/plastic part that goes between your toes has a very sharp edge.The plastic actually digs into your flesh across the whole foot, as the edge is sharp all the way down the plastic strip.After 10 seconds of exposure to these flip flops, I was experiencing much pain, and my foot was red from the sharp edges. I had to cut the edges of the rubber off with a knife and wrap it in cling filmIf you would like to use these flip flops as a torture device, then I highly recommend them, if like me, you just want a normal pair of flip flops, look elsewhere.

Why?
Have had quite a few pairs of flip flops over the years, primarily Animal and Reef brands, with a pair of Teva flip flops on the side, and not forgetting Fat Face. I thought I'd try these Havaianas to see whether they matched up to the promise, and, well, they don't. Two main issues... the rubber toe post, and the lack of any arch support. I've only once before had rubber flip flops, those were Fat Face, and they came with a fabric toe post. They were fine. However, these Havaianas are just not comfortable for me, and I really don't think any amount of forced time spent with them epuld change that. Additionally, not sure the 'straps' would survive the passage of time, as they're already half way through the sole out of the box. I'd hate to be walking along and the straps just 'pop out'. For what it's worth I did my research, and these appear to be genuine, so any complaints I have can't be put down to dodgy goods. There are far better flip flops out there, and yes, they cost more, but does that really matter? I'd rather have comfortable and, potentially, more durable flip flops on my feet. If you want supreme comfort, spend your money elsewhere. And, if you're going to say "hey you didn't break them in", don't bother, plenty of flip flops don't need breaking in, while these are about breaking *you* in. For my money (yes!), the most comfortable flip flops I've had are Animal Faders (three pairs), followed by the expensive and gimmicky Reef Fanning.
